Abstract

Steroid therapy has been proven beneficial in the treatment of SARS-CoV2 in various trials all around the world. However, the dosing and timing of this therapy are crucial and still under debate. Studies exist regarding the use of Pulse IV therapy of steroids in this illness, but it has still not been widely used and accepted throughout the world. Here we describe four cases of SARS-CoV2 who presented to a tertiary care center in India within the first week of illness, with moderate to severe disease activity. These patients were treated with Pulse doses of intravenous MethylPrednisolone. All four patients showed positive outcomes in terms of oxygen requirement and early recovery.
